SLU is one of Sweden’s most research intensive universities - almost 70 per cent of our work is in research. At the university we develop knowledge, skills and know-how in the field of biological natural resources and biological production.

Thanks to our research, SLU can offer students a wide range of Master's programmes in unique fields. You will have numerous opportunities for interesting in-depth studies and specializations.
Understanding the life processes of plants, animals and microbes is an essential element in our use of nature. SLU is responsible for almost one third of all biological research in Sweden. Our training spans a broad spectrum and our Master’s programmes are based on SLU’s strengths and profile areas. Animal science, landscape architecture, biotechnology and environmental economics are just a few examples.

The education is diverse and you can study both natural or social sciences and how they relate to biological natural resources. Our courses are adapted to the European educational system, which makes it easy for our students to study abroad, for our international students to study here and it prepares them for a growing international labour market.

Last but not least, SLU is one of Sweden’s universities with the highest proportion of PhD-lecturers per student. The university is also number one when it comes to the percentage of students moving on to postgraduate research. All of this has made SLU one of the top-ranked universities in Sweden.
